Программы для подготовки 3D модели к печати: Полный гид по слайсерам

Процесс создания физического объекта из цифрового файла требует промежуточного этапа, который часто называют «слайсингом». Без правильного программного обеспечения даже самая совершенная 3D-модель останется лишь набором полигонов на экране монитора. Специализированный софт переводит геометрию в язык, понятный принтеру, разбивая объект на слои и генерируя траекторию движения экструдера.

Выбор программы для подготовки 3D модели к печати зависит от множества факторов: типа используемого оборудования, материала, сложности геометрии файла и вашего опыта. Рынок предлагает как простые решения «нажал кнопку и печатай», так и мощные инструменты с глубокими настройками для профессионалов. Разобраться в этом многообразии и подобрать оптимальный инструмент — задача критически важная для успешного результата.

Что такое слайсинг и зачем он нужен

Термин слайсинг происходит от английского слова «slice» (разрезать). Программа берет трехмерную модель, обычно в формате STL или OBJ, и «разрезает» её на сотни или тысячи горизонтальных слоев. Результатом этого процесса является G-код — файл с инструкциями, содержащий координаты перемещения, скорость печати, температуру сопла и стола, а также параметры обесшкуривания.

Каждый слой в программе визуализируется как контур. Вы можете увидеть, как именно сопло будет двигаться, где будут наложены поддержки и где произойдет смена цвета. Это позволяет предвидеть потенциальные проблемы, такие как столкновение сопла с моделью или образование воздушных карманов, еще до начала физического процесса. Без качественной подготовки вы рискуете испортить filament и получить брак.

Использование современного слайсера позволяет оптимизировать время печати без потери прочности детали. Вы можете выбирать между скоростью и качеством, меняя высоту слоя в Layer Height. Правильная настройка поддерживает структуру предотвращает обрушение нависающих элементов, что критично для сложных геометрических форм.

Лидеры рынка: Cura и PrusaSlicer

На данный момент двумя самыми популярными решениями являются Ultimaker Cura и PrusaSlicer. Ultimaker Cura отличается огромным сообществом пользователей и тысячами готовых пресетов для различных принтеров. Интерфейс программы интуитивно понятен, что делает её идеальным выбором для новичков, желающих быстро получить результат.

С другой стороны, PrusaSlicer (ранее Slic3r Prusa Edition) славится своей логичной структурой настроек и продвинутыми алгоритмами автоматической генерации поддержек. Он часто работает быстрее Cura и позволяет создавать более качественные структуры поддержек типа «tree supports». Это особенно важно при печати моделей со сложной геометрией, где стандартные колонны лишь усложняют постобработку.

Обе программы являются Open Source, что означает их бесплатность и возможность доработки сообществом. Вы можете найти плагин для автоматической ориентации детали или скрипт для изменения скоростей в определенных зонах. Однако важно понимать, что функционал постоянно обновляется, и старые версии могут не поддерживать новые материалы.

📊 Какой слайсер вы используете чаще всего?
Ultimaker Cura
PrusaSlicer
Bambu Studio
Собранное решение из исходников

Специализированный софт для экосистем

В последние годы производители принтеров начали выпускать собственный софт, глубоко интегрированный с их «железом». Например, Bambu Studio для принтеров Bambu Lab или FlashPrint от Flashforge. Эти программы часто содержат уникальные функции, недоступные в общих слайсерах, такие как автоматическое калибрование потока или управление камерой.

Использование родного ПО от производителя гарантирует максимальную совместимость с прошивкой принтера. Вы получаете точные пресеты для фирменных материалов, которые настроены инженерами завода. Это снижает риск ошибок при настройке, но ограничивает вас в выборе оборудования — вы привязаны к одному бренду.

Тем не менее, многие продвинутые пользователи предпочитают универсальные решения, даже если у них есть принтер от крупного бренда. Это дает свободу экспериментировать с настройками, которые могут быть скрыты в фирменном интерфейсе. Иногда стандартные пресеты слишком консервативны, и ручная настройка позволяет выжать из принтера на 10-15% больше качества.

⚠️ Внимание: Интерфейсы и версии ПО часто меняются. Функции, доступные в Bambu Studio сегодня, могут быть перенесены в облако или изменены в следующем обновлении. Всегда сверяйтесь с официальным чейнджлогом перед обновлением софта, чтобы не потерять привычные настройки.

Ключевые параметры настройки в слайсере

Успех печати зависит не от «магии» программы, а от правильного понимания её параметров. Самым важным является высота слоя. Меньшая высота обеспечивает лучшую детализацию, но увеличивает время печати. Для технических деталей часто используют 0.2 мм, а для фигурок с лицом — 0.1 мм или меньше.

Не менее критична настройка плотности заполнения. Для декоративных объектов достаточно 10-15%, чтобы сэкономить материал и время. Для функциональных узлов, подвергающихся нагрузкам, плотность повышают до 40-60%. Важно также выбрать паттерн заполнения: gyroid обеспечивает равномерную прочность во всех направлениях, а grid — классический выбор для простых задач.

Грамотная настройка скоростей печати позволяет избежать артефактов. Внешние периметры печатают медленно для идеальной поверхности, а внутренние заполнения — быстро. Температура экструдера и стола также должны быть точно подобраны под конкретный тип пластика: PLA, PETG, ABS или Nylon требуют разных тепловых режимов.

☑️ Чек-лист перед отправкой на печать

Выполнено: 0 / 4

Сравнительная таблица популярных слайсеров

Чтобы проще было выбрать подходящее решение, рассмотрим основные характеристики наиболее востребованных программ в таблице ниже. Это поможет сопоставить возможности софта с вашими потребностями.

Программа Тип лицензии Сложность Уникальная фишка
Ultimaker Cura Open Source Низкая/Средняя Огромное количество плагинов
PrusaSlicer Open Source Средняя Умные поддержки Tree
Bambu Studio Проприетарное Средняя Интеграция с камерой/сетью
Lychee Slicer Freemium Высокая Лучшее для фотополимерных принтеров

Обратите внимание, что Lychee Slicer и Chitubox доминируют в сегменте фотополимерной (SLA/DLP) печати, так как там требуются совершенно иные алгоритмы подготовки, включая удаление поддержек и рендеринг масок. Для FDM-принтеров (пластиковая нить) они используются редко.

Ошибки и решения при подготовке модели

Одной из самых частых проблем является наличие «неводостойких» полигонов в модели, таких как дыры или пересекающиеся поверхности. Большинство слайсеров имеют встроенный инструмент ремонта. В Cura это кнопка «Repair», в других программах — функция «Fix Mesh». Игнорирование этих ошибок может привести к тому, что принтер начнет печатать в воздухе или зависнет.

Другая распространенная ошибка — неправильный масштаб модели. Часто скачанные файлы находятся в миллиметрах, а слайсер ожидает сантиметры, или наоборот. Это приводит к тому, что деталь печатается в 10 раз меньше или больше необходимого. Всегда проверяйте габариты модели в окне предпросмотра перед началом процесса.

Иногда слайсер не может корректно определить ориентацию детали, ставя её на острые углы. В этом случае необходимо вручную повернуть объект, чтобы он стоял на более широкой основе. Это также влияет на количество необходимых поддержек и их качество снятия.

Как найти скрытые ошибки в STL файле?

Используйте режим рентгеновского просмотра в слайсере или специализированные программы вроде Netfabb для анализа геометрии перед импортом.

⚠️ Внимание: Если программа выдает сообщение о «пересекающихся полигонах» или «незамкнутой сетке», не пытайтесь печатать такую модель. Это гарантированно приведет к браку или поломке экструдера. Используйте инструменты ремонта геометрии.

Автоматизация и продвинутые функции

Современные слайсеры предлагают функции автоматической ориентации, которые рассчитывают положение детали для минимизации поддержек или улучшения прочности. Это может сэкономить вам часы ручной работы. Алгоритмы анализируют векторы напряжений и предлагают оптимальное положение для печати.

Также становится популярной функция варпированного охлаждения (variable cooling), когда вентилятор работает на разных скоростях в зависимости от высоты слоя. Для мелких деталей вентилятор включается на 100%, а для крупных массивных узлов — на 30% или выключается, чтобы избежать деформации от резкого перепада температур.

Некоторые продвинутые пользователи используют скриптовые расширения для автоматического изменения настроек в середине печати. Например, смена цвета нити или изменение скорости в конкретной зоне, где деталь наиболее критична к качеству поверхности. Это требует глубокого понимания G-кода.

В заключение стоит отметить, что программа для подготовки 3D модели к печати — это инструмент, который требует обучения. Даже самая дорогая и мощная утилита не спасет от ошибок в настройках температуры или скорости. Экспериментируйте с параметрами, тестируйте образцы и адаптируйте софт под ваши конкретные задачи.

Помните, что идеальной программы не существует: то, что подходит для печати PLA фигурок, может быть совершенно бесполезно для инженерных деталей из нейлона. Подбирайте инструмент под материал и задачу, и результат не заставит себя ждать.

Какой слайсер лучше для новичка?

Для новичков наиболее подойдет Ultimaker Cura из-за простоты интерфейса и огромного количества готовых пресетов для популярных принтеров.

Нужно ли платить за слайсер?

Нет, большинство популярных программ, таких как Cura и PrusaSlicer, являются полностью бесплатными и имеют открытый исходный код. Платные версии обычно предлагают дополнительные функции для бизнеса или специфические инструменты.

Что делать, если слайсер не видит принтер?

Убедитесь, что вы добавили принтер в настройки программы вручную или установили правильный профиль. Иногда требуется обновление драйверов или прошивки самого принтера.

Можно ли использовать один слайсер для разных типов принтеров?

Да, такие программы как Cura и PrusaSlicer поддерживают широкий спектр принтеров различных брендов, позволяя создавать и настраивать профили для каждого устройства отдельно.